The case for this PCR assay for aspergillus DNA remains unproven; and that proof can only be obtained by undertaking a formal prospective study in which samples for the detection of galactomannan and fungal DNA by PCR are taken at several predetermined intervals eg, 2-3 times weekly from all patients at risk.

A fourth pathogen, Rickettsia parkeri, has been identified as a newly identified cause of rickettsial spotted fever in the United States.
